在正方体ABCD-A1B1C1D1中,M为DD1的中点,O为底面ABCD的中心,P为棱A1B1上任意一点,则直线OP与直线AM所成的角是( )
|
答案
解:(特殊位置法)将P点取为A1,
作OE⊥AD于E,连接A1E,
则A1E为OA1在平面AD1内的射影,
又AM⊥A1E,
∴AM⊥OA1,即AM与OP成90°角.
故选D.
